What is Carbon Capture? ? ? Carbon capture is the process of capturing CO2 emissions from industrial sources such as power plants, factories, and even natural gas facilities. Instead of allowing these gases to be released into the atmosphere, carbon capture technologies trap the carbon and store it securely underground or use it for various industrial purposes. The ultimate goal is to significantly reduce the amount of CO2 in the atmosphere, thus mitigating the effects of global warming . Why Is Carbon Capture Important? ? ? The importance of carbon capture lies in its potential to contribute to a substantial reduction in global emissions. Traditional methods of reducing CO2, like switching to
renewable energy sources, are vital, but they alone are not enough to reach the targets needed to stave off the worst impacts of climate change. Carbon capture offers an additional layer of protection by addressing emissions from hard-to-decarbonize sectors such as cement production, steel manufacturing, and heavy-duty transportation . Types of Carbon Capture Technologies ⚡ ⚡ Carbon capture involves a variety of methods and techniques, each with its unique applications. From post-combustion capture to direct air capture, these technologies are evolving rapidly. Here are some of the most prominent carbon capture solutions: •Post-Combustion Capture This method captures CO2 after fossil fuels are burned for energy. It is one of the most widely used technologies in coal and natural gas power plants. The CO2 is separated from the flue gases using chemical solvents and stored in geological formations for long-term storage. •Pre-Combustion Capture This process involves removing CO2 before combustion occurs, often in gasification systems. The fuel is partially oxidized to produce CO2 and hydrogen. The CO2 is then captured and stored, leaving hydrogen as the cleaner fuel source. •Oxyfuel Combustion Oxyfuel combustion involves burning fossil fuels in pure oxygen rather than air. This creates a more concentrated stream of CO2, which is easier to capture and
separate. Oxyfuel combustion can be highly effective in reducing CO2 emissions from power plants. •Direct Air Capture (DAC) DAC is a revolutionary technology that captures CO2 directly from the ambient air. It uses large-scale facilities equipped with machines that suck in air and extract CO2. The captured CO2 can then be stored underground or used in products like synthetic fuels. •Bioenergy with Carbon Capture and Storage (BECCS) This technology combines biomass energy production with carbon capture. Plants absorb CO2 from the atmosphere during photosynthesis. When these plants are used for energy production and the CO2 is captured and stored, BECCS can lead to negative emissions, effectively removing CO2 from the atmosphere. The Role of Svante in Carbon Capture ? ? Svante Inc. is at the forefront of innovative carbon capture solutions, providing state-of- the-art technology that captures CO2 in a more efficient and cost-effective manner. Their solutions are designed to be scalable, adaptable, and economically viable for industries seeking to reduce their carbon footprint. With a focus on engineering and innovation, Svante’s carbon capture solutions offer businesses the opportunity to make a meaningful impact in their sustainability goals. Their patented technology captures CO2 using a solid adsorbent material rather than traditional liquid-based solvents, which can be expensive and inefficient. This solid adsorbent process is not only more efficient but also more environmentally friendly . Svante’s solution is ideal for industries in need of reducing emissions, and it is already making a difference in sectors such as cement, steel, and natural gas production. With continued innovation, Svante’s technology holds the potential to capture millions of tons of CO2 annually, driving the world closer to achieving its emission reduction targets .

The Future of Carbon Capture ️ ️ The future of carbon capture is incredibly promising. With continued advancements in technology, the cost of capturing and storing CO2 is expected to decrease significantly. This will make carbon capture more accessible to a wider range of industries, accelerating its adoption worldwide. Governments are also stepping up their efforts, with many offering incentives, grants, and policies designed to promote the development and implementation of carbon capture solutions. As these solutions evolve, industries will be better equipped to meet global emission reduction targets, enabling a more sustainable and carbon-neutral future .
